“The cat in sheep’s clothing”, “The velcro cat”, “the teddy bear cat”
Many names for the Selkirk Rex, but all true. Originating in Montana in the 1980s, when Persian breeder Jere Newman, came across a strange sight one day in her barn. A cat with curly fur!
Over the years and many outcrosses including American Shorthairs, British Shorthairs, and yes even the Persian that started it all, the Selkirk Rex has grown to be a driving force in the cat world.
With their affectionate, laidback, and silly personalities, they are a staple of any household whether engaged in a large family dynamic, or a tried-and-true companion for those who need a little love in their lives.
